Bank Robbery Suspect Sought

A black male six feet tall with a medium build and between 20 and 30 years old is responsible for five bank robberies since January, according to police. The suspect first struck a Chase Bank at 118- 30 Queens Blvd., Forest Hills on January 8. Two weeks and four days later, on January 26, he robbed a Washington Mutual Bank at 106-11 71st Ave. and on February 26 robbed the North Fork Bank at 107-18 Continental Ave. All three robberies were within the confines of the 112th Police Precinct.
The suspect then moved operations to Astoria. On March 13, he robbed the Sovereign Bank at 37-10 Broadway and on March 26 the Queens County Savings Bank at 30-75 Steinway St., both locations within the 114th Precinct.
In each case, the suspect entered the bank, produced a note demanding money and fled the bank with United States currency in undisclosed amounts.
Anyone with information is requested to call New York City Police Department Detective Salvatore Abusio of the Major Case Squad, Special Investigations Division at 718-276-3470 or 646-610-6910.
